Baling MP’s graft trial postponed for Parliament attendance


Abdul Azeez Abdul Rahim is charged with three counts of allegedly receiving bribes totalling RM5.2 million over road projects in Perak and Kedah, and nine counts of money laundering involving more than RM140 million. – The Malaysian Insight file pic, August 18, 2020.

FORMER Lembaga Tabung Haji (TH) chairman Abdul Azeez Abdul Rahim and his brother, Abdul Latif, had the first day of their corruption trial today vacated to allow the former to attend the Dewan Rakyat sitting.

According to Malaysiakini, following an application by Azeez’s lawyer, Hisham Teh Poh Teik, Kuala Lumpur Sessions Court judge Azura Alwi agreed to postpone the trial to tomorrow.

“Abdul Azeez is needed in the Dewan Rakyat after it was made compulsory for all government lawmakers to be present today, when the finance minister tables the Temporary Measures for Reducing The Impact of Coronavirus Disease 2019 Bill 2020 for its second reading,” Hisyam was quoted as saying by the news portal.

Deputy public prosecutors Aslinda Ahad and Nik Haslinie Hashim did not raise any objections.

Azura then allowed the application and vacated today’s proceedings. She ordered that proceedings start tomorrow at 9am with the first witness to take the stand.

On January 16 last year, Azeez was charged with three counts of allegedly receiving bribes totalling RM5.2 million over road projects in Perak and Kedah, and nine counts of money laundering involving more than RM140 million.

On the same day, Latif was charged with two counts of allegedly abetting Azeez in committing the offences.

The charges come under Section 16(a)(A) of the Malaysian Anti-Corruption Commission (MACC) Act 2009, while the money-laundering charges are under Section 4(1)(b) of the Anti-Money Laundering, Anti-Terrorism Financing and Proceeds of Unlawful Activities Act 2001. – August 18, 2020.
